Durban man hospitalised after being impaled on fence
Updated | By ECR Newswatch
A man who was seriously injured after being impaled on a fence at the weekend is receiving specialised treatment in hospital.

Paramedics arrived on scene on Saturday evening to find a man, believed to be in his 20s, impaled on a fence along Masabalala Yengwa Avenue, that is the old NMR Avenue, in the vicinity of Smiso Nkwanyana (Goble) Road.
Emergency services say the man had fallen onto the fence and was found hanging upside down by his legs.
Rescue Care's Garrith Jamieson says emergency services and Durban firefighters used specialised equipment to cut and lower part of the fence.
Police are investigating the circumstances that led to the incident.
